Practical considerations for use and care are straightforward. The tablet cut and low profile make the stone well suited to ring designs where protection of the pavilion is desirable, and it will also perform well in pendants and earrings where a broad display of color is preferred. As a natural White Opal from Australia with no enhancements, the gem should be cleaned gently with a soft, damp cloth and mild soap when necessary, avoiding prolonged exposure to heat and harsh chemicals to preserve its response to light. For professional mounting, ensure the setting offers support across the base to prevent leverage on the tablet form, and consider protective bezel or secure prong placement for everyday wear.
